Nettet27. apr. 2024 · Earth is 4.543 billion years old. The Sun is 4.603 billion years old. Earth Scientists know how old the Earth is based on rocks on the surface of the earth using radiometric dating. Isotopes of some radioactive elements decay into other elements in predictable rates. The Earth and the Moon form the Earth-Moon satellite system with a shared center of mass, or barycenter. This barycenter stays located at all times 1,700 km (1,100 mi) (about a quarter of Earth's radius) beneath the Earth's surface, making the Moon seemingly orbit the Earth.
